Cavs VS Rabun Gap and GA Force

Anderson CAVS Middle School 0   Rabun Gap JV 14

The CAVS took on a much different Rabun Gap squad than the first one they played and defeated.  Rabun Gap played 10th graders virtually the entire game against our middle school team.  Regardless, the CAVS played tough defense and gave up a long scoring pass right before halftime to fall behind 0-7.  The CAVS defense played great against the larger Rabun Gap team.  The CAVS offense missed out on several scoring opportunities and fell short as Rabun Gap added a late TD with several missed tackles.

The Season comes to an end with a tough loss….will keep us hungry for next season.  The CAVS finish with a 7-0 record against middle school teams and 0-3 against JV teams for an overall record of 7-3.

Anderson CAVS Varsity 0  Georgia Force 35

 The CAVS varsity was young this year and it showed as the finished up the season with a tough loss to a well seasoned GA Force team.  The CAVS played tough all year and we look for great things next season with virtually the entire team returning and with the addition of ten or more middle school players.  The CAVS finish up the year at 4-6.  The CAVS should be in line to win a championship next season.

Cavs VS GA Force and Augusta Prep

CAV Middle 33  Georgia Force 14

The Cavalier team came out firing and did it by the air and by the ground.  The CAVS put up over 350 yards of offense as the entire team saw action.  The CAVS move to 7-2 with one game to go.

CAV Varsity 14  Augusta Prep 28

The CAVS led 7-0 at halftime.  Augusta Prep played ball control and added a late touchdown in a very hard fought conference match-up.  The CAVS still have a small chance at the GFC play-offs if they beat the Georgia Force in the final regular season game this next week.

Cavaliers VS BCA

Anderson Cavalier Middle school team 58  BCA  27

The entire team saw plenty of action as the CAVS move to 6-2 on the season.

Anderson CAV Varsity 34  East Atlanta 28

The CAV varsity team went on the road and delivered with a conference win.  The CAVS are 4-4 on the season and have a shot at the play-offs.  East Atlanta led 14-0 at halftime and the CAVS came charging back in the 2nd half for 34 points.  Jordan Kelly had two huge interceptions and Jamond Thomason rushed for 4 touchdowns.  The CAV Defense stood tall in the 2nd half.

Cavs VS North ATL & Holy Spirit Prep

Anderson Cav Middle 0  North Atlanta JV 14

The Anderson Cavaliers played an older JV team which will move to varsity next season.  The CAVS played great defense but turned the ball over in crucial situations for the first time this season.  It was a very tough loss and the CAVS will have to bounce back next week.

Anderson CAV Varsity 6  Holy Spirit Prep 32

The CAV varsity hosted the leading team in the GFC conference for the first conference game of the season.  The CAVS played tough but were overpowered by a more seasoned team.  The CAV varsity will play a 2nd conference game next week at East Atlanta.

The Homecoming 2011 night was a great night and the teams collected over $6,500 for ministry.  Praise God!  We had the largest crowd in Cavalier history and look for great things to come!  We are still building and growing!  Go CAVS!!!!!!
